Batavia: Giving Voice to the Voiceless is a publication documenting the exhibition of the same title at the Lawrence Wilson Art Gallery (2017) and the Geraldton Regional Art Gallery (2018). The book features essays by artists, curators and researchers of the 1629 Batavia shipwreck from the University of Western Australia, the Western Australian Museum and Edith Cowan University that examine the infamous maritime disaster and subsequent mutiny from archaeological, historical and artistic perspectives. It also includes the list of works and high resolution images of artworks exhibited.
